​Designer Maker User

Thursday, Nov 24, 201610 AM — Saturday, Nov 24, 20185:45 PMBST

The Design Museum, 224-238 Kensington High Street, W8 6AG London, GB London, GB | The Design Museum, 224-238 Kensington High Street, W8 6AG

Designer Maker User presents the museum’s collection to look at the development of modern design through these three interconnected roles.

Designer Maker User features almost 1000 items of twentieth and twenty-first century design viewed through the angles of the designer, manufacturer and user, including a crowdsourced wall. The exhibition covers a broad range of design disciplines, from architecture and engineering, to the digital world, fashion and graphics. Designer Maker User features a bold, colourful and engaging display designed by Studio Myerscough, with digital interactives by Studio Kin.
